Europe Wrap: Son, Mitoma shine; Jahanbakhsh nets on UCL debut


<div><div>
<div>Kuala Lumpur: Son Heung-min grabbed the headlines in the North London derby as his double helped Spurs secure a 2-2 draw against Arsenal on Sunday while Kaoru Mitoma also scored twice in England this week. </div>
